I’m Molly Deahl and I’m a Business Liaison with the West Kentucky Workforce Board. One of the programs offered through the Workforce Board to our employers is On the Job Training. On-the-Job Training (OJT) is a work based training model that is designed to compensate the employer for lost production time and other training costs associated with hiring new employees. The employer hires an eligible individual, and agrees to train them in a new position, where the individual is being paid $12/hr or more with benefits. During the pre-determined training period, the WKWB will reimburse the employer 50% of the individual’s’ wages on a monthly basis. The goal of this program is that the employer gains a trained asset for their company, while getting some money back in their pocket, and the individual obtains self-sustaining employment.
